meteor是否自动加载了css文件

时间:2014-11-06 09:41:38

标签: meteor

我发现我不需要在头部编写css链接。但是css仍然可以工作。如果是这样,那么如何管理我的css文件。例如,在不同的页面中使用不同的css文件。

3 个答案:

答案 0 :(得分:1)

目前,你有这样的事情:

<template name="myTemplateName">
    <p>HTML!</p>
</template>
/* Should only affect paragraphs in the template above. */
p{
    color: red;
}

您必须将其更改为以下内容:

<template name="myTemplateName">
    <div class="myTemplateName">
        <p>HTML!</p>
    </div>
</template>
/* Will only affect paragraphs in the "template" above. */
.myTemplateName p{
    color: red;
}

答案 1 :(得分:0)

使用名为template和meteor的css文件将包含它

答案 2 :(得分:0)

Meteor适用于SPA - Single Page Application。在SPA中,所有Css文件都将被编译并缩小为单个文件,并在初始页面加载时提供给客户端。它与Html和Javascript文件相同。在流星中,它是七个核心原则之一(Data on the wire)。在初始页面加载后,客户端和服务器之间唯一的事情就是数据,而不是HTML或Css内容。

Meteor团队致力于控制文件加载顺序的机制。查看trello板以获取信息。